    New Zealand Cricket's high performance boss Bryan Stronach insists time will not be a motivating factor in either of the calls they're about to make about the Black Caps coach


    Gary Stead has indicated he no longer wants to coach the side in limited overs formats and is contemplating whether he still wants to be the test coach.

    At the same time, NZC is considering whether they are comfortable with a split coaching model for the first time.



    Stronach himself is leaving the organisation once a replacement for his role has been found.
